客户端发送一个search请求到Node 3,Node 3会创建一个大小为from + size的空优先队列。 Node 3将查询请求转发到索引的每个主分片或副本分片中。每个分片在本地执行查询并添加结果到大小为from + size的本地有序优先队列中。 每个分片返回各自优先队列中所有文档的 ID 和排序值给协调节点,也就是Node 3,它合并这...
Elasticsearch: 权威指南 » 深入搜索 » 结构化搜索 » 精确值查找 « 结构化搜索 组合过滤器 » 精确值查找 当进行精确值查找时, 我们会使用过滤器(filters)。过滤器很重要,因为它们执行速度非常快,不会计算相关度(直接跳过了整个评分阶段)而且很容易被缓存。我们会在本章后面的 过滤器缓存 中讨论过滤...
集群健康 | Elasticsearch: 权威指南 | Elastic 集群健康 一个Elasticsearch 集群至少包括一个节点和一个索引。或者它可能有一百个数据节点、三个单独的主节点,以及一小打客户端节点——这些共同操作一千个索引(以及上万个分片)。 不管集群扩展到多大规模,你都会想要一个快速获取集群状态的途径。Cluster HealthAPI 充当...
ElasticSearch权威指南:深入搜索(下) 五、部分匹配 敏锐的读者会注意,目前为止本书介绍的所有查询都是针对整个词的操作。为了能匹配,只能查找倒排索引中存在的词,最小的单元为单个词。 但如果想匹配部分而不是全部的词该怎么办?部分匹配允许用户指定查找词的一部分并找出所有包含这部分片段的词。
Elasticsearch 权威指南(中文版) 1、入门 Elasticsearch 是一个实时分布式搜索和分析引擎。 它让你以前所未有的速度处理大数据成为可能。它用于全文搜索、结构化搜索、分析以及将这三者混合使用 :维基百科使用 Elasticsearch 提供全文搜索并高亮关键字, 以及输入实时搜索 (search-as-you-type) 和搜索纠错 (did-you-mean...
Elasticsearch权威指南(中文版) 1、入门 Elasticsearch是一个实时分布式搜索和分析引擎。它让你以前所未有的速度 处理大数据成为可能。 它用于全文搜索、结构化搜索、分析以及将这三者混合使用: 维基百科使用Elasticsearch提供全文搜索并高亮关键字,以及输入实时搜索 (search-as-you-type)和搜索纠错(did-you-mean)等搜索建...
Apache Kylin权威指南8.4 ZooKeeper8.1 我要写书评 Elasticsearch: The Definitive Guide的书评 ···(全部 0 条) 读书笔记 ···(共5篇) 我来写笔记 按有用程度 按页码先后 最新笔记 展开 1.1.5 索引 jerryleooo(Time will tell) Elasticsearch集群...
Elasticsearch: 权威指南 按需水平、垂直扩容 Elasticsearch定义 一个分布式的实时文档存储,每个字段 可以被索引与搜索 一个分布式实时分析搜索引擎 能胜任上百个服务节点的扩展,并支持 PB 级别的结构化或者非结构化数据 开源协议: Apache 2 license JAVA API---端口使用9300...
Elasticsearch 权威指南〔中文版〕 1、入门 Elasticsearch是一个实时分布式搜索和分析引擎。它让你以前所未有的速度处理大数据成为可能。 它用于全文搜索、结构化搜索、分析以及将这三者混合使用: 维基百科使用Elasticsearch提供全文搜索并高亮关键字,以及输入实时搜索(search-as-you-type)和搜索纠错(did-you-mean)等搜索...